Pelayo González is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Physiology and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ine. According to data from OpenAlex, Pelayo González has authored 23 papers receiving a total of 677 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 9 papers in Molecular Biology, 6 papers in Physiology and 5 papers in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ine. Recurrent topics in Pelayo González’s work include Alzheimer's disease research and treatments (4 papers), Renin-Angiotensin System Studies (3 papers) and Genetic Associations and Epidemiology (2 papers). Pelayo González is often cited by papers focused on Alzheimer's disease research and treatments (4 papers), Renin-Angiotensin System Studies (3 papers) and Genetic Associations and Epidemiology (2 papers). Pelayo González collaborates with scholars based in Spain, Italy and United States. Pelayo González's co-authors include Victoria Álvarez, Eliécer Coto, A. Cortina, Julián R. Reguero, Alberto Batalla, Ruth Álvarez, Gustavo Iglesias-Cubero, Aurora Astudillo, Roberto Martínez Álvarez and Mónica García‐Castro and has published in prestigious journals such as Clinical Chemistry, Talanta and Clinical Science.
